August 22 Historical Events

The following events took place on August 22. The list is arranged in chronological order.

  • 392
    Arbogast has Eugenius elected Western Roman Emperor.
  • 476
    Odoacer is named Rex italiae by his troops.
  • 565
    Columba reports seeing a monster in Loch Ness, Scotland.
  • 851
    Battle of Jengland: Erispoe defeats Charles the Bald near the Breton town of Jengland.
  • 1138
    Battle of the Standard between Scotland and England.
  • 1485
    The Battle of Bosworth Field, the death of Richard III and the end of the House of Plantagenet.
  • 1559
    Bartolomé Carranza, Spanish archbishop, is arrested for heresy.
  • 1639
    Madras (now Chennai), India, is founded by the British East India Company on a sliver of land bought from local Nayak rulers.
  • 1642
    Charles I calls the English Parliament traitors. The English Civil War begins.
  • 1654
    Jacob Barsimson arrives in New Amsterdam. He is the first known Jewish immigrant to America.
  • 1711
    Ships from British Admiral Hovenden Walker’s Quebec Expedition flounders on rocks at the mouth of the Saint Lawrence River.
  • 1717
    Spanish troops land on Sardinia.
  • 1770
    James Cook names and lands on Possession Island, Queensland and claims the east coast of Australia as New South Wales in the name of King George III.
  • 1777
    American Revolutionary War: British forces abandon the Siege of Fort Stanwix after hearing rumors of Continental Army reinforcements.
  • 1780
    James Cook’s ship HMS Resolution returns to England (Cook having been killed on Hawaii during the voyage).
  • 1791
    Beginning of the Haitian Slave Revolution in Saint-Domingue.
  • 1798
    French troops land in Kilcummin harbour, County Mayo, Ireland to aid Wolfe Tone’s United Irishmen’s Irish Rebellion.
  • 1827
    José de la Mar becomes President of Peru.
  • 1831
    Nat Turner’s slave rebellion commences just after midnight in Southampton County, Virginia, leading to the deaths of more than 50 whites and several hundred African Americans who are killed in retaliation for the uprising.
  • 1846
    The Second Federal Republic of Mexico is established.
  • 1848
    The United States annexes New Mexico.
  • 1849
    The first air raid in history. Austria launches pilotless balloons against the city of Venice.
  • 1851
    The first America’s Cup is won by the yacht America.
  • 1864
    Twelve nations sign the First Geneva Convention.
  • 1875
    The Treaty of Saint Petersburg between Japan and Russia is ratified, providing for the exchange of Sakhalin for the Kuril Islands.
  • 1902
    Cadillac Motor Company is founded.
  • 1902
    Theodore Roosevelt becomes the first President of the United States to ride in an automobile.
  • 1910
    Korea is annexed by Japan with the signing of the Japan–Korea Treaty of 1910, beginning a period of Japanese rule of Korea that lasted until the end of World War II.
  • 1922
    Michael Collins, Commander-in-chief of the Irish Free State Army, is shot dead during an Anti-Treaty ambush at Béal na Bláth, County Cork, during the Irish Civil War.
  • 1932
    The BBC first experiments with television broadcasting. (See also Timeline of the BBC.)
